Information and Communication Technology
blank

ICT has enormous potential not just for national curriculum. It will change the way we learn as well as the way we work.

(Chris Yapp, ICL Fellow Longlife learning)

In our rapidly changing world, it is essential for children to be equipped with good ICT skills and from an early age the children are trained using computers. We are fortunate enough to have a new up-to-date ICT suite, which the whole school has access to during an ICT lesson. All the computers are networked and all have internet facilities. The children have their own log-on codes and all classes make use of the suite.

Although much of ICT is cross curricular, we also have lessons where the children are taught specific skills needed to operate a computer efficiently, in line with the QCA documents.

There is an ICT club, which runs at lunchtime and is open to any of the junior children.
